Just a little poll to set my priority list...

Guys, I have some projects in mind which I could work on next, but I can't decide which one should I focus on first. By voting to this poll you can help me decide :)

Here are the projects which I am thinking about currently and have some data to start with. As for tracks, there are 3 racing circuits and 1 hillclimb track. All these tracks were already made for AC but I would like to create more accurate and more recent versions, at least in the quality of my Slovakia Ring. As for the car, I would like to finish the Clio Cup 4 project. Those Clios were already replaced with 5th gen mods, but I think gen 4 is so good that it deserves proper (legal) mod for AC. The car which i already have here at my patreon has "borrowed" 3D model from PCars, I would love to be able to share it publicly as fully legal mod.

TCR cars are currently on hold. There will be some updates soon when I will receive new sounds for all three cars, Honda for now is not possible, I don't have data nor 3D model for now.

I was actually lucky, I was contacted by a guy Heikki who did pretty decent version for rfactor 2, it was made from photogrammetry scan which he did by himself, it is on par with laserscanned version, the whole project looked very promising. But... Heikki is working still on the track, it is almost finished. He even gave me his Blender project to help with my conversion, but for some strange reason, I struggle to load his mesh into ksEditor. It always freezes, no errors, no warning, it is stuck at the fbx loading forever. No idea why. I tried some old tricks, tried to convert it to various fbx formats, tried to split meshes, apply some 3dsmax magic on it yet still the track fails to load into ksEditor. I am desperate and I am loosing possibilities what to do with it. This is first time I had these kind of issues with 3D mesh.
